Output 84ff7c6e31dae18522c6fe6e74d79b61c542a23867249691a9753f00a3a7d227:17

value
675380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8caf1dc9e4bbea7f536ee1a91d04d2395a4fcac OP_EQUAL
address
3H5WZczCxhyksmJJfeCx8mi5XNQC559xeB
transaction
84ff7c6e31dae18522c6fe6e74d79b61c542a23867249691a9753f00a3a7d227
spent
true